Jeff on the Issues: A Healthier Florida
- Supported the Florida KidCare Program to provide low-cost health insurance for children
- Helped to give high-risk pregnant women vital, affordable prenatal care
- Supported the Health Flex Program to let low-income families get health insurance
- Crafted historic and innovative Medicaid reforms
- Increased health care quality and patient safety through the Patient Protection Act of 2000, the Florida Commission on Excellence in Health Care, and the Florida Patient Safety Corporation
- Implemented the Gold Seal Program to promote and recognize excellence in long-term care facilities and increase training in nursing homes, home health agencies, hospices and adult day care centers
- Increased the transparency of health care information to better allow Floridians to make informed decisions about health care
- Created several centers for disease research, the Women and Heart Disease Task Force and the Florida Alzheimer’s Center and Research Institute
- Invested hundreds of millions of dollars in grants to encourage research and innovation in disease prevention

Taking Care of Our Children and Seniors
Jeff Atwater supports the Florida KidCare Program which provides low-cost health insurance for children and the Health Flex Program to cover low-income families. Vital prenatal care programs for at-risk pregnant women are also a key priority for Jeff Atwater.
Jeff Atwater wants to help maintain Medicaid and Medicaid Long-Term Care continue to serve seniors by cutting inefficiencies and spiraling costs with historic and innovative reforms. He will work to create customer choice-driven programs in Medicaid and the Medicaid Long-Term Care program.
Quality and Safety In Medical Care
Jeff Atwater believes that improving patient safety and quality of care is just as important as increasing affordability and accessibility. He passed the Patient Protection Act, helped form the Florida Commission on Excellence in Health Care, the Florida Patient Safety Corporation and the Gold Seal Program to promote and recognize excellence in long-term care facilities.
